Output ef71800b810dc415a6953026724f609fe0a464aea4ebb79be08b1af89b8aaf1c:11

value
64892721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c580472baf9accfcbc18b3394e5e2ac9c29e905b OP_EQUAL
address
MRuT28gKGQ8U6icLSzh3GBiKu5d1tRRMVd
transaction
ef71800b810dc415a6953026724f609fe0a464aea4ebb79be08b1af89b8aaf1c
spent
true